The Rise of Organic Food
Organic food refers to agricultural products that are produced using natural methods and without the use of synthetic chemicals, genetically modified organisms (GMOs), or irradiation.
The popularity of organic food has soared in recent years, with many people perceiving it as a healthier and safer alternative to conventionally grown food.
One of the reasons for this surge in demand is the belief that organic food carries a lower risk of cancer. However, scientific studies have failed to provide substantial evidence to support this claim.

The Pesticide Paradox
One of the primary reasons why individuals opt for organic food is to reduce exposure to pesticides, which are widely used in conventional agriculture. Pesticides are used to control pests, weeds, and diseases that can hinder crop growth.
There is no denying that exposure to high levels of certain pesticides can increase cancer risk.
However, it’s important to note that in most cases, the pesticide residue found on conventionally grown food falls within safe levels prescribed by regulatory authorities such as the Environmental Protection Agency (EPA) and the European Food Safety Authority (EFSA).
Furthermore, studies have consistently found that the dietary benefits of consuming fruits and vegetables, whether grown organically or conventionally, far outweigh the potential risks associated with pesticide exposure.
The World Health Organization (WHO) even states that the health benefits of consuming a diet rich in fruits and vegetables outweigh the potential risks of pesticide residue.
Organic Food vs. Conventional Food: Is There a Difference?
While organic and conventional foods may differ in terms of agricultural practices, nutrient composition, and pesticide residue, it is crucial to understand that these differences do not directly translate into differences in cancer risk.
A systematic review published in the British Journal of Nutrition in 2012 analyzed over 50 years of research comparing organic and conventional food.
The review concluded that there is no evidence to suggest that organic food has a higher nutritional value than conventionally grown food or that it carries a lower cancer risk.
Similarly, a large-scale study conducted by Stanford University in 2012 found no significant nutritional difference between organic and conventionally grown produce.
The study also concluded that there is currently no strong evidence to support the claim that organic food is safer or healthier than conventional food in terms of cancer risk.
The Role of GMOs
Genetically modified organisms (GMOs) have been a topic of debate and concern for many individuals. Some people believe that consuming GMOs increases the risk of developing cancer.
However, extensive research conducted by reputable scientific organizations such as the National Academy of Sciences and the World Health Organization has repeatedly concluded that GMOs are safe for consumption.
Regulatory agencies thoroughly evaluate the safety of GMOs before allowing their commercialization.
Rigorous testing and scientific consensus support the safety of GMO crops, which have been on the market for over two decades without any compelling evidence connecting them to cancer or other health issues.
